In a significant move poised to reshape the grocery landscape, Kroger has announced its intent to acquire the Giant Eagle supermarket chain for an estimated $1.65 billion. This acquisition, pending regulatory approval, marks a crucial step for Kroger as it aims to expand its reach and enhance its competitive edge in the bustling retail market.

Regulatory Hurdles Ahead
While the acquisition appears to be a strategic win for Kroger, it will face scrutiny from regulatory bodies concerned with market competition. The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) is expected to evaluate the deal closely to ensure it does not create monopolistic practices in local markets. The outcome of this examination could set a precedent for future mergers in the retail sector.
